public final class Screen extends Object
Screen
オブジェクトの境界は、Screen.primary
を基準にしています。
例:
Rectangle2D primaryScreenBounds = Screen.getPrimary().getVisualBounds();
//set Stage boundaries to visible bounds of the main screen
stage.setX(primaryScreenBounds.getMinX());
stage.setY(primaryScreenBounds.getMinY());
stage.setWidth(primaryScreenBounds.getWidth());
stage.setHeight(primaryScreenBounds.getHeight());
stage.show();
修飾子と型 | メソッドと説明 |
---|---|
boolean |
equals(Object obj)
このオブジェクトと他のオブジェクトが等しいかどうかを示します。
|
Rectangle2D |
getBounds()
この
Screen の境界を取得します。 |
double |
getDpi()
この
Screen の解像度(インチ当たりのドット数)を取得します。 |
static Screen |
getPrimary()
プライマリ
Screen 。 |
static ObservableList<Screen> |
getScreens()
現在使用可能な
Screens の監視可能リスト。 |
static ObservableList<Screen> |
getScreensForRectangle(double x, double y, double width, double height)
指定した矩形と交差している
Screens のObservableListを返します。 |
static ObservableList<Screen> |
getScreensForRectangle(Rectangle2D r)
指定した矩形と交差している
Screens のObservableListを返します。 |
Rectangle2D |
getVisualBounds()
この
Screen の視覚境界を取得します。 |
int |
hashCode()
この
Screen オブジェクトのハッシュ・コードを返します。 |
String |
toString()
この
Screen オブジェクトの文字列表現を返します。 |
public static Screen getPrimary()
Screen
。public static ObservableList<Screen> getScreens()
Screens
の監視可能リスト。public static ObservableList<Screen> getScreensForRectangle(double x, double y, double width, double height)
Screens
のObservableListを返します。x
- 指定された矩形領域の左上隅のx座標y
- 指定された矩形領域の左上隅のy座標width
- 指定された矩形領域の幅height
- 指定された矩形領域の高さScreen.bounds
が指定された矩形と交差している、Screens
のObservableListpublic static ObservableList<Screen> getScreensForRectangle(Rectangle2D r)
Screens
のObservableListを返します。r
- 指定されたRectangle2D
Screen.bounds
が指定された矩形と交差している、Screens
のObservableListpublic final Rectangle2D getBounds()
Screen
の境界を取得します。Screen
の境界public final Rectangle2D getVisualBounds()
Screen
の視覚境界を取得します。これらの境界はタスク・バーやメニュー・バーなどのネイティブのウィンドウ処理システムのオブジェクトを処理します。これらの境界は、Screen.bounds
に含まれます。Screen
の視覚境界public final double getDpi()
Screen
の解像度(インチ当たりのドット数)を取得します。public int hashCode()
Screen
オブジェクトのハッシュ・コードを返します。public boolean equals(Object obj)
Copyright (c) 2008, 2015, Oracle and/or its affiliates. All rights reserved.